OS X is not UNIX.

It may have a certification of being UNIX-compatible, but the important aspects are very different.

UNIX was created as a portable operating system and pushed for simple but reliable design that is naturally extensible.

OS X is a walled garden locked to specific hardware where you are forbidden to touch things for your own safety and has an XML-based init system (so much for simplicity).

If anything, OS X is a regression in the field of operating systems.

That part of my post is objectively true, whether you think GNU actually manages to be better or not.

GNU adds easier to remember, more consistent long options, adds optimizations that vastly increase performance, favors correctness over simplicity (which shows up in fuzz testing), and so on. It doesn't try to be just like Unix, it tries to be better than Unix.
